During a working trip to Lviv, President Volodymyr Zelenskyy honored the memory of Ukraine's defenders perished in the Russian-Ukrainian war. Head of the President's Office Andriy Yermak and his deputies, as well as Head of the Lviv Regional Military Administration Maksym Kozytskyi, paid tribute to the fallen warriors together with the Head of State. The President and the leadership of the Office of the President laid flowers at the graves of the heroes buried at the Field of Mars at the Lychakiv Cemetery. These are soldiers and sergeants fallen in battles with the Russian occupiers in the spring of 2022 and early 2023. In particular, the participants of the ceremony honored the memory of Maksym Vasylkevych from Lviv, who performed combat missions in the ATO area in the east of Ukraine for three years, and after the full-scale invasion of Russia returned from abroad and fought the enemy as part of the 110th separate mechanized brigade named after General-Corporal Marko Bezruchko; Oleksiy Lion, a native of Rubizhne, Luhansk region, who fought as part of the 24th separate mechanized brigade named after King Danylo; Dmytro Sydoruk, an internationally recognized master of sports in archery, junior sergeant of the 24th separate mechanized brigade. Volodymyr Zelenskyy also spoke with the mother of Lieutenant Pavlo Shcherbyna, who was the commander of a separate grenade launcher platoon, participated in the liberation of Kherson, and later fought in the Bakhmut sector. He perished on December 15, 2022. The Lychakiv Military Cemetery is a military burial ground in Lviv. Since April 2022, the victims of the Russian-Ukrainian war are buried in its central part. |
